Chateau Cap de Faugeres

Consistently ranked as one of the finest estates in Bordeaux`s Cotes de Castillon region, Cap de Faugeres has been the beneficiary of strong investment in recent years following its acquisition by Swiss perfumer Silvio Denz, who also owns luxury glassmaker Lalique. The 46-hectare vineyard in the village of Sainte-Colombe is chiefly planted to Merlot, with Cabernets Franc and Sauvignon filling the remainder. Consistently excellent, both in quality and value.

Bordeaux

Undoubtedly the most well-known fine wine region on the planet, the French wine region of Bordeaux spans 120,000 hectares of vineyard and is demarcated by the Gironde Estuary and its two main tributaries, the Garonne and the Dordogne. The region is divided into the Left Bank, for vineyards located on the left bank of the Garonne River, and the Right Bank, for vineyards on the right bank of the Dordogne. Famous Left Bank appellations such as Pauillac, Saint-Julien, Saint-Estephe and Margaux are well-known for their quality, but value is also found in Haut-Medoc and Moulis. The Right Bank is well known for Pomerol and Saint-Emilion, while the upcoming regions of Lalande-de-Pomerol and Cotes de Bordeaux Castillon should not be overlooked. Close to the city Sauternes and Barsac make some of the world's best sweet wines, while the appellations of Pessac-Leognan and Graves do a fine line in rich reds and full-bodied whites. Red Bordeaux wines are made from a blend of grapes, and the permitted varieties are Merlot, Cabernet Sauvignon, Cabernet Franc, Petit Verdot and, less commonly, Malbec and Carmenere. Very broadly speaking, Right Bank wines will have a predominance of Merlot, while Left Bank wines will rely on Cabernet Sauvignon as the primary variety in a blend. White wines, both dry and sweet, are made from Sauvignon Blanc, Semillon and Muscadelle.

Cotes de Bordeaux Castillon

Sold as Cotes de Castillon until 2009, when several appellations were brought under a new umbrella region called Cotes de Bordeaux. Located right on the eastern fringe of the Bordeaux wine region, all of the wines produced in Cotes de Bordeaux Castillon are red. Merlot, Cabernet Franc and Cabernet Sauvignon are the most planted varieties, but some Malbec and Carmenere can be found. The soils are clay and gravel based with Merlot mainly found in the clay soils and Cabernet Sauvignon planted in the gravels. The wines typically have structure and rich flavour and can be drunk early or cellared for a few years.

Bordeaux Red Blend

Red Bordeaux wines are most often made from a blend of grapes, officially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, Cabernet Franc, Petit Verdot, Malbec and Carmenere. The term is now used across the world to emulate the style of the famous blended wines of Bordeaux, and will be made in the same style in the majority of examples. When very broadly referring to Bordeaux wines, Left Bank wines will have a higher proportion of Cabernet Sauvignon, while Right Bank wines use Merlot as the dominant partner in the blend.
